Pool deck demolition services involve the careful removal of existing concrete, pavers, or other decking materials surrounding a swimming pool. This process typically includes breaking up and carting away the old surface, preparing the area for a new installation, and ensuring the underlying structure is solid and ready for the next phase. Homeowners often seek this service when their current pool deck has become damaged, cracked, or uneven, making it unsafe or unappealing.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to carry out the demolition efficiently, minimizing disruption to the surrounding landscape and property.
These services help address a variety of problems that can develop over time with pool decks. Cracks, sinking sections, and surface deterioration can pose safety hazards and detract from the property's overall appearance. In some cases, old decks may no longer match a homeowner’s aesthetic preferences or may be outdated in style. Demolition allows for a clean slate, enabling property owners to replace worn-out surfaces with modern, durable materials such as stamped concrete, pavers, or other decorative options. This process can also facilitate repairs to underlying structural issues that may have caused the deck’s deterioration.

The overview below groups typical Pool Deck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in O Fallon,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or pool deck demolition projects in O Fallon, MO range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ering tasks like removing small sections or damaged areas.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um, which may involve additional preparation or cleanup.
Moderate Demolition - For more extensive deck removal,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ects usually involve removing larger sections or multiple areas, and the cost can vary based on deck size and complexity. Many jobs in this range are common for mid-sized pool decks.
Full Deck Replacement - Complete demolition and replacement of a pool deck typically costs between $4,000 and $8,000 in the O Fallon area. Larger, more complex projects can reach $10,000+, especially if there are additional structural or site prep requirements. Most full replacements fall into the mid to high tiers of this range.
Specialized or Complex Projects - Very large or intricate demolition jobs, such as those involving custom designs or extensive site work, can exceed $10,000. These projects are less common and often involve additional challenges that increase labor and material costs.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
